By the way, I came across such a problem:
http://img22.imageshack.us/img22/7155/tengentproblem.jpg
The hard shadow appears when tangent shading is turned on. There are no sharp edges or double vertices here. Am I doing something wrong or is this a common problem?

Negative: Normals are correct, so that’s not the case. The problem disappears when rendering with Ambient Occlusion turned off.
